Our customer is looking for a Creative Project Manager on a contract basis to help support their ongoing business needs. This role is hybrid (2-3 days on-site/week) at 20 hours per week in Milwaukee, WI.
Responsibilities
- Intake and manage creative project requests from marketing, enterprise, and internal resource teams
- Build and maintain project schedules, timelines, and resource plans
- Coordinate internal creative teams, business partners, and external agency partners to ensure timely delivery
- Track project progress and proactively resolve scheduling, resourcing, and workflow issues
- Maintain detailed project documentation and status updates using project management tools
- Support stakeholder alignment and negotiation to keep projects on track
- Monitor short- and long-term projects, including those requiring ongoing follow-up
- Collaborate heavily through digital communication tools to manage workflows and dependencies
- Support projects related to branding, regulatory filings, and creative asset coordination
- Take on increasing responsibility as capability and reliability are demonstrated
- 1–3 years of experience in a creative, marketing, or agency environment
- Internship or academic experience in a creative field is acceptable
- Understanding of creative workflows and production processes
- Strong attention to detail with the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ills
-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to collaborate across teams and partners
- Ability to problem-solve and keep projects, people, and deliverables aligned
- Experience working in or alongside an agency environment preferred
- Familiarity with project management tools preferred
- Willingness to learn, adapt, and take on new responsibilities
- Ability to work independently as an individual contributor
